Udostępnia funkcję usuwania zarejestrowanej aktywności użytkownika.
Uwaga: do wykonania tej operacji wymagane jest standardowe konto użytkownika. Konto usługi nie może bezpośrednio wykonywać żądań usuwania aktywności. Aby używać konta usługi do wykonywania zapytań, skonfiguruj przekazywanie uprawnień w całej domenie Google Workspace.
Żądanie HTTP
POST https://cloudsearch.googleapis.com/v1/query:removeActivity
Adres URL używa składni transkodowania gRPC.
Treść żądania
Treść żądania zawiera dane o następującej strukturze:
Zapis JSON |
---|
{ "userActivity": { object ( |
Pola | |
---|---|
userActivity |
Aktywność użytkownika zawierająca dane do usunięcia. |
requestOptions |
opcje żądania, takie jak aplikacja wyszukiwania i clientId; |
Treść odpowiedzi
W przypadku powodzenia treść odpowiedzi jest pusta.
Zakresy autoryzacji
Wymaga jednego z tych zakresów OAuth:
https://www.googleapis.com/auth/cloud_search.query
https://www.googleapis.com/auth/cloud_search
Więcej informacji znajdziesz w przewodniku dotyczącym autoryzacji.
UserActivity
Aktywność użytkownika związana z pojedynczymi lub zbiorczymi zapytaniami. Może to być zapytanie dotyczące rejestrowania lub usuwania.
Zapis JSON |
---|
{ // Union field |
Pola | |
---|---|
Pole unii
|
|
queryActivity |
Zawiera dane, które należy zarejestrować lub usunąć. |
QueryActivity
Szczegóły dotyczące aktywności użytkownika związanej z zapytaniami.
Zapis JSON |
---|
{ "query": string } |
Pola | |
---|---|
query |
Zapytanie użytkownika do zarejestrowania/usunięcia. |